Nyzhni Vorota (ukr. Нижні Ворота) is a village located in western Ukraine, Transcarpathian region, in the Mukachevo region. It is a picturesque village located at the foot of the Carpathian Mountains, near the borders with Hungary, Slovakia and Poland, making it an attractive tourist spot.

The surrounding Carpathian Mountains are a popular tourist destination, offering numerous hiking trails including hiking and biking trails. The region is also known for its winter sports opportunities, such as skiing and snowboarding. Nyzhni Vorota is also a great base for exploring other mountain towns in the Transcarpathian region.

Nyzhni Vorota has a rich cultural and folklore heritage, related to Ukrainian, Hungarian and Slovak influences in the region. Residents still cherish local traditions, customs and festivals that attract tourists and people interested in the culture of the Carpathian Mountains.

Nyzhni Vorota is an ideal place for those seeking peace, contact with nature and mountain landscapes. Thanks to its location, traditions and the charm of the surrounding mountains of the Carpathian Mountains, it is an attractive destination for tourists and those seeking a break from the hustle and bustle of big cities.

Pompeii - a tour of the ancient city

This is one of the biggest tourist attractions in Italy - a place besieged by tourists, regardless of the season. The ruins of the ancient city, whose power was annihilated during the eruption of Mount Vesuvius, are quite a treat for lovers of antiquity and history in general. The city was "hibernated" in a layer of ash and pumice. Pompeii began to revive like a Phoenix from the ashes only in the 18th century, when excavations began. Archaeological work continues to this day.

Pompeii is an Italian city that was destroyed during the Roman Empire by the eruption of the Vesuvius volcano. Lava and volcanic ash perpetuated the buildings, objects used by the settlers and even their bodies. Pompeii is considered by historians to be a symbol of antiquity.
